By the way if you are changing the light I suggest not to follow the how to, way too long and troublesome going from inside the boot. I took a flat tip screw driver push on the flat side of the cover (the other side is rounded right) and the cap comes off so easily. Zero chance of breakage. Swap and bulbs, snap on and voila!

#16: Re: rear numberplate light Author: craigdmjv, Location: WiltshirePosted: Fri Aug 26, 2011 12:40 pm ---- are the ones in the link ok with mux cars and can you get pulled over by the police driving around with only one working
Once you're out in the bulb holder, mux'ed or not makes no difference, it's just plain 12V.
What can matter with LED bulbs is that they draw less current than regular incandescent bulbs, and a light bulb monitoring system can therefore think that the bulb is broken. But AFAIK no 206 has such a system (someone please correct me if that's wrong)
There are LED bulbs that incorporate an extra resistor in parallel, in order to increase the current draw to a level where the monitoring system is happy...
#18: Re: rear numberplate light Author: Ash, Location: Running from Ant and Lee and Adam...........Posted: Fri Aug 26, 2011 5:37 pm ---- They'll be fine in the 206 for side lights, numberplate lights, glovebox (if its the same as interior), interior light and boot light.
